The DCT (Application for a Duplicate) is the official form used to replace a lost, stolen, or damaged licence disc or clearance certificate.

The licence disc is the sticker on your windscreen; the registration certificate (RC1) is the ownership document. Use the DCT to replace a disc/clearance, and the DRC to replace the registration certificate.
